STATE NOTICE AND PRIVACY RIGHTS
The New Jersey Data Privacy Act or “NJDPA” (N.J. Stat. § 56:8-166) and the California Consumer Privacy Act or “CCPA” (Cal. Civ. Code § 1798.100 et seq.) (collectively, “State Laws”), afford consumers residing in New Jersey and California, respectively, certain rights with respect to their personal information. If you are a job applicant or business partner who resides in California, you are considered a consumer and have certain rights with respect to your personal data. So, in addition to the notices provided above, if you are a consumer, as described here, residing in New Jersey or California, this section applies to you as indicated
The State Laws require that we provide transparency about personal information we “sell,” “share,” or use for targeted advertising. “Sale,” for the purposes of the State Laws, broadly means scenarios in which we have disclosed personal information with partners in exchange for valuable consideration, while “sharing” means we have disclosed information to a third party for cross-context behavioral advertising. In addition, the CCPA has been interpreted to deem this “sharing” to also be a form of “sale.” We never disclose your personal data in exchange for money; however, we do disclose certain categories of personal data (that do not identify you personally) to show you targeted ads on third-party properties and to expand the reach and effectiveness of our own marketing campaigns. These activities may be considered “sales,” “sharing,” or “targeted advertising” under certain state laws. See below for details about your privacy rights, including opt-out rights.
We do not knowingly sell or share personal information about consumers under the age of 17.
Subject to certain limitations, you have the right to (1) request to know more about the categories and specific pieces of personal information we collect, use, and disclose, (2) request correction of your personal information, (3) request deletion of your personal information, and (4) not be discriminated against for exercising these rights.
